Kenya AA Kamwangi comes from the Kamwangi washing station, part of the New Ngariama Farmers Cooperative Society in Kirinyaga county in Kenya’s central highlands, where around 1,500 smallholder farmers cultivate varieties such as SL28, Batian and Ruiru 11 at altitudes up to 1,800 masl. The cherries are hand-sorted before being pulped, fermented for 24-36 hours under shade, washed and graded by density, then sun-dried on raised beds with protection from sun and night moisture, producing a clean, lively washed coffee with vibrant fruit character. Kamwangi has built a strong reputation for quality over many seasons, reflecting the diligence of its farmers and mill staff and supporting the cooperative model that underpins livelihoods across the local coffee community in this volcanic, high-elevation growing region.
